Chapter 1
Mid-flight on her trip abroad, Yara Dye suffered a sudden asthma attack. She survived only thanks to the passenger sitting beside her, Annie Jensen, who administered emergency first aid. As Yara finally caught her breath and was about to thank her, she heard Annie speak with a soft smile. "If you want to thank someone, thank my husband. He's the one who taught me how." Annie gently stroked her swollen belly. "Think of it as me putting a little good karma out there for the baby." Yara's gaze dropped to the diamond ring glinting on Annie's finger, and she couldn't help but sigh softly. "You two have such a sweet marriage." "Right? You have no idea how clingy and fussy he can be." A sweet, just-a-little-exasperated smile tugged at Annie's lips. "Even the sweater I'm wearing? He knitted it." The mention of a devoted husband made Yara think of Shawn Ewing, and a soft, tender smile bloomed on her face. On their seventh wedding anniversary, Shawn had given her a matching ring, vowing to love only her for the rest of his life. This trip abroad was a secret. Yara had planned to come back unexpectedly on his birthday and surprise him. Quiet anticipation filling her, she stepped through the arrival gate the moment the plane landed. Almost immediately, she spotted a tall, slender figure in a trench coat standing a little ways ahead. Joy flared bright in her eyes. Before she could call out to him, Annie threw herself straight into the man's arms, calling out affectionately, "Honey!" In an instant, every inch of Yara's body went ice-cold. She froze on the spot like a statue, watching Shawn lean down and press a soft kiss to Annie's forehead. "The temperature dropped today. Why didn't you throw on another layer?" Shawn slipped off his trench coat and draped it gently over Annie's shoulders. Mid-motion, his gaze lifted and locked onto Yara, standing alone in the distance. Their eyes met. In that instant, tears welled up and glistened in Yara's reddening eyes. "I saved someone on the plane today," Annie blinked, snapping out of it. She grabbed Yara's hand, tugged her closer, and said to Shawn, her tone playful, "We hit it off right away. Honey, let's grab dinner together later." "Sure." Shawn's expression flickered, but he recovered quickly. He offered his hand to Yara and introduced himself, his eyes carrying a clear warning. "Hey there, I'm Shawn Ewing." Yara pressed her lips tight and didn't say a word. Shawn continued. "So, you're over here visiting family?" Family. The second that word left his mouth, Yara snapped back to reality, her whole body trembling. Three years earlier, her mother had been diagnosed with a genetic disease and was receiving treatment overseas. Shawn had covered every last bill. He was using her mother to threaten her. A dull, sharp ache twisted in Yara's chest, and she couldn't find the words. Finally, in a hoarse voice, she said, "...Hello." Annie beamed. "She's here to meet her husband. Shawn, isn't that such a crazy coincidence? Your birthdays are on the exact same day." "Oh, really? That's quite a coincidence." Shawn answered casually, then wrapped an arm around Annie's shoulders. "Annie, go check out the car. I set up a little surprise for you." "Ooh, sounds nice." Annie headed off, all smiles. Shawn stood there for a short second, then lifted his eyes to Yara and said, ice-cold, "You've got some nerve, going behind my back to dig into me." "I wasn't..." "Keep what happened between us from Annie. She's pregnant and emotional right now. We'll talk when you're back home." Shawn cut her off sharply, his tone all command. "I had my assistant book you a hotel and a return flight. Go home early, and don't follow us." With that, he turned without a second thought and guided Annie toward the car. Cradling a bouquet of bright red roses, Annie waved at Yara regretfully through the car window. "Yara, if you've got stuff to do, we can hang out next time." Yara's heart was breaking, but she forced a stiff smile and nodded. The car pulled away into the distance, leaving Yara alone on the freezing winter streets of London, sobbing her heart out.
